LOCATE A STORAGE FACILITY NEAR ME IN PHILADELPHIA

Locate a Storage Facility Near Me in Philadelphia

Your Overview to Locating the Best Storage Space FacilityDiscovering the world of storage space facilities can be a daunting task, particularly with the wide range of options readily available. As you navigate via the procedure of choosing the suitable storage service, a number of essential factors come right into play, influencing your decision-ma

read more